How much do freelance data center design jobs pay per hour?
As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for freelance data center design in Addison, IL is $47.80,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.33 and $61.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.
Freelance data center design involves independently providing planning, architecture, and engineering services for data centers. Freelancers in this field work with organizations to design efficient, secure, and scalable facilities that house IT infrastructure, ensuring optimal power, cooling, and network systems. They may handle projects ranging from new builds to upgrades or expansions, often collaborating remotely or onsite. Freelance data center designers typically have expertise in electrical, mechanical, and IT systems, as well as knowledge of industry standards and regulations.
To thrive as a Freelance Data Center Designer, you need expertise in electrical and mechanical engineering, knowledge of data center standards, and relevant experience or degrees in engineering or architecture. Proficiency with CAD software, building information modeling (BIM) tools, and familiarity with certifications like Uptime Institute's Tier Certification or LEED are typically required. Strong project management, communication, and problem-solving skills help you coordinate with clients and multidisciplinary teams. These skills ensure that data centers are designed for efficiency, reliability, and scalability while meeting client and industry standards.
Freelance data center design professionals frequently collaborate with a range of stakeholders throughout a project, including architects, electrical and mechanical engineers, IT managers, and construction teams. These collaborations ensure that the design meets technical requirements, energy efficiency standards, and client specifications. Effective communication and coordination are essential, especially when integrating new technologies or adhering to industry compliance standards. Regular meetings and updates are common to align on project milestones and resolve design challenges promptly.
